What's a QR Code?

Distilled from the Wikipedia page on QR codes:

QR code is an abbreviation of Quick Response code Matrix barcode (or 2-D code) -- other matrix barcodes exist! First designed for and used by automotive industry, specifically Toyota subsidiary Denso Wave, in 1994

What are all those boxes for? Picture showing elements of a QR code

A QR code can encode any kind of data, alphanumeric, binary, kanji, etc.

The QR code is an ISO standard, and the use of QR codes is free of any license. The term is trademarked by Denso Wave Incorporated.

How do you read them?

In marketing, they are intended to be read by mobile devices.

You need an app installed that can read QR codes. This can be a general barcode reader, or specifically a QR code reader.

Android

Barcode Scanner (free) -- displays the URL or text before it does anything with it QR Droid (free) ScanLife Barcode Reader (free)

From http://www.socialmediaexaminer.com/5-steps-to-a-successful-qr-code-marketing-campaign/ --

  1. Plan your QR code campaign strategy
  2. Create quality codes and test them
  3. Link your codes to mobile-friendly or mobile-optimized sites
  4. Track your scans with code management systems
  5. Deliver value and a favorable user experience
